Menu
+968 9596 3381
Phone Number
info@setupinoman.com
Email Address
Mon - Thu: 8:00 - 5:00
Online store always open
Phone Number
Email Address
Online store always open
WhatsApp Us Today
Drop Us an Email Today
Google Map Location
Saturday to Thursday
Muscat, the dynamic capital of Oman, is emerging as a hub for entrepreneurship and innovation. With a stable economy, supportive government policies, and a strategic location, 2025 is offering a wealth of opportunities for you if you are looking to Start Your Business in Muscat. Whether you’re an aspiring entrepreneur or an established business owner, Muscat provides a fertile ground for growth and success.
At setupinoman, we specialize in simplifying the business setup process in Muscat. Our tailored solutions and expert guidance ensure that you can focus on growing your business while we handle the complexities of registration and compliance.
2025 offers several compelling reasons to start your business in Muscat:
Starting a business in Muscat comes with numerous benefits:
Strategic Location: Positioned as a gateway to GCC, African, and Asian markets.
Thriving Economy: Diverse growth sectors, including oil & gas, tourism, IT, and manufacturing.
Government Incentives: Pro-business policies, tax exemptions, and foreign investment support.
Skilled Workforce: Access to a pool of qualified professionals and a supportive labor market.
High Living Standards: A modern city with excellent infrastructure and quality of life.
At setupinoman, we provide comprehensive support to help you start your business in Muscat:
Business Consultation
Understand your goals and recommend the most suitable business structure.
Provide insights into industry-specific regulations and market dynamics.
Company Formation
Assistance with registering your business with the Ministry of Commerce, Industry, and Investment Promotion (MoCIIP).
End-to-end support for document preparation and submission.
Licensing and Permits
Secure trade licenses, industry-specific permits, and environmental clearances.
Facilitate approvals from local municipal authorities.
Local Sponsorship (if required)
Help connect with reliable Omani sponsors to meet local ownership requirements for mainland companies.
Post-Setup Support
Assistance with tax registration, bank account setup, and visa applications.
Ongoing compliance support, including license renewals and audit filings.
Choose Your Business Structure
Decide on the legal structure, such as Limited Liability Company (LLC), branch office, or free zone entity.
Reserve a Trade Name
Select a unique and compliant business name for registration.
Prepare Required Documents
Draft the Memorandum of Association (MOA) and gather all necessary documents.
Register with Authorities
Submit your application to MoCIIP and secure initial approvals.
Obtain Licenses and Permits
Acquire trade licenses and other permits relevant to your business activity.
Set Up Your Office
Secure a physical office space in Muscat, as required for licensing.
Launch Your Business
Open bank accounts, hire staff, and begin operations.
Starting a Business in Muscat is a streamlined process that typically takes 3–7 days if all necessary preparations are in place. Below is a breakdown of the main steps involved in Starting a Business in Muscat and their estimated completion times:
Initial Consultation & Planning (1 Day): Discuss your business goals and determine the best structure for your Muscat company setup, whether an LLC, SPC, or Branch Office.
Name Registration (1–2 Days): Choose and register a unique business name that complies with Muscat’s Ministry of Commerce regulations.
Drafting & Signing the Memorandum of Association (MOA) (1 Day): Prepare and sign the MOA, which outlines your company’s objectives, management structure, and capital. This essential document is a blueprint for your business.
Government Registration & Approvals (1–2 Days): Obtain all necessary business licenses in Muscat, including the Investment License and Commercial Registration (CR) Certificate.
Want to expedite the process? Having all required documents ready will speed up the steps. For a smoother experience, consider our professional business setup services in Muscat to guide you through each stage of company formation in Muscat seamlessly.
Expertise in Omani Regulations: Our team’s deep understanding of local laws ensures your business meets all compliance requirements.
Customized Solutions: We tailor our services to suit your specific needs, whether you’re a startup or an established business.
Efficient and Transparent: We simplify the registration process with clear timelines and no hidden fees.
Comprehensive Support: From documentation to post-registration services, we’re with you every step of the way.
1. What is the minimum capital requirement to start a business in Muscat? The capital requirement varies based on the business type and ownership structure. For foreign-owned LLCs, it is typically OMR 150,000.
2. Can foreigners fully own a business in Muscat? Yes, foreign investors can own up to 70% of a business in the mainland. Certain free zones allow for 100% foreign ownership.
3. How long does the business setup process take? The process usually takes 2-4 weeks, depending on the complexity and approvals required.
4. What industries are thriving in Muscat? Key growth sectors include tourism, logistics, IT, construction, healthcare, and renewable energy.
5. Do I need a local sponsor to start a business in Muscat? For mainland businesses, a local Omani sponsor owning 30% of the shares is required. Free zones, however, allow full foreign ownership.
Starting a business in Muscat in 2025 is an exciting venture, and we are here to make the process as smooth and successful as possible. With our comprehensive services and expert guidance, you can focus on what matters most – building and growing your business.
Oman’s business environment is increasingly investor-friendly, with flexible tax and labor regulations designed to support new initiatives in Oman as they establish and grow. Understanding these regulations, especially around corporate tax and labor requirements, can help you make the most of Oman’s pro-business landscape.
Oman’s corporate tax system is simple and favorable, particularly for new businesses:
These straightforward rates make tax planning easier for businesses of all sizes, allowing you to focus on growth and expansion.
VAT is set at a competitive rate from tax authority of Oman, applying only to local sales and certain services:
Oman’s labor laws are business-friendly from ministry of labor of Oman, particularly for new investors looking to establish a workforce:
This gradual approach to Omanization makes it easier for foreign businesses to adapt while fulfilling local employment initiatives at a comfortable pace.
Oman offers a balanced workweek, with standard working hours that align with international norms:
1. What licenses are required to start a tourism company in Muscat? Tourism companies typically require a travel agency license, tour operator license, or related permits depending on the business activity.
2. Can foreigners fully own a tourism company in Muscat? Foreigners can own up to 70% of a tourism business in the mainland. Free zones allow for 100% ownership.
3. How long does it take to set up a tourism company in Muscat? The process usually takes 3-6 weeks, depending on the completeness of documentation and approvals.
4. What is the minimum capital requirement for a tourism company in Muscat? The minimum capital varies depending on the ownership structure and business activity. Generally, OMR 150,000 is required for foreign-owned companies.
5. Are there special requirements for inbound tourism services? Yes, inbound tourism operators must comply with specific regulations from the Ministry of Heritage and Tourism.
Do not hesitate to contact us. We’re a team of experts ready to talk to you.